Basically, the answer is no. Very roughly, stock prices go up because there are more people who want the buy than who want to sell, and vice versa. And, the amount that the price rises is generally roughly proportional to the amount of buying vs the amount of selling.

If you are a beginner to invest, you should know what you're preparing before you decide which stocks to buy.WebThe primary emotions that make stocks go up or down are fear and greed. When investors are greedy, they tend to buy more, which drives the price of stocks up, up, and up. However, when investors are fearful, they sell, and sell quickly, which causes the price of stocks to drop. December soybean meal was down $6 to close at $444.30 ... tmf ex dividend dategood stocks for beginners to buy Jan 26, 2022 · Stock prices are affected by supply and demand. Because the stock market functions as an auction, when there are more buyers than there are sellers, the price has to adapt, or no trades will be made.
